Decoding Local Housing Trends: Understanding Property Dynamics

Various factors, including economic conditions, demographics, and market forces, influence local housing trends. Deciphering these trends is essential for homeowners, buyers, sellers, and investors to make informed decisions in the real estate market. Let’s explore how to decode local housing trends and understand property dynamics.

One key indicator of local housing trends is home sales data, including the number of homes sold, median sale prices, and days on the market. Analyzing this data over time can reveal patterns and trends in the local market, such as seasonal fluctuations, inventory levels, and buyer demand.

Another factor to consider when deciding local housing trends is economic indicators, such as job growth, income levels, and unemployment rates. A strong economy typically correlates with a healthy housing market, as more people can afford homeownership and invest in real estate.

Demographic trends also play a significant role in shaping local housing dynamics. Population growth, migration patterns, and household formations can impact housing demand and preferences, influencing housing supply, property values, and neighborhood development.

Furthermore, market forces, such as interest rates, lending practices, and government policies, can influence local housing trends. For example, changes in mortgage rates or lending standards can affect affordability and buyer demand, while zoning regulations or tax incentives may impact property development and investment opportunities.

Analyzing local housing trends requires a comprehensive approach incorporating data analysis, market research, and qualitative insights. Real estate professionals, economists, and industry experts often use various tools and methodologies to assess market conditions and forecast future trends.

By understanding local housing trends and property dynamics, homeowners, buyers, sellers, and investors can confidently make informed decisions and navigate the real estate market. Whether buying, selling, or investing, staying abreast of local housing trends is essential for success in the dynamic and ever-changing real estate landscape.
